vue cli3 es6转es5 文心快码BaiduComate 要将Vue CLI 3项目中的ES6代码转换为ES5,以确保在旧版浏览器中也能正常运行,可以按照以下步骤进行配置和转换: 1. 安装并配置Babel 首先,确保安装了必要的Babel依赖。在项目根目录下运行以下命令来安装@babel/core、@babel/preset-env和其他相关依赖: bash
3. 在项目根目录创建一个.babelrc文件 里面内容 最基本配置是: {//此项指明,转码的规则"presets": [//env项是借助插件babel-preset-env,下面这个配置说的是babel对es6,es7,es8进行转码,并且设置amd,commonjs这样的模块化文件,不进行转码["env", { "modules":false}],//下面这个是不同阶段出现的es语法,包...
include: [resolve('src'), resolve('test')], exclude: /node_modules/ .babelrc { "presets": [ ["env", { "modules": false, "targets": { "browsers": ["> 1%", "last 2 versions", "not ie <= 8"] } }], "stage-2" ], "plugins": ["transform-vue-jsx", "transform-runtime"]...
而在Vue-cli的打包过程中,它以ES为中心,将源代码转换为浏览器可执行的代码,实现了代码的压缩和优化,提高了网页加载速度和用户体验。 Vue-cli打包为ES的过程中,主要包括以下几个方面的内容: 1. 代码转换:Vue-cli使用Babel来进行代码转换,将ES6及以上版本的代码转换为ES5的语法,以保证在各种浏览器中的兼容性。通...
Check the features neededforyour project: (Press <space> toselect, to toggle all, to invert selection)>( ) Babel//转码器,可以将ES6代码转为ES5代码,从而在现有环境执行。( ) TypeScript//TypeScript是一个JavaScript(后缀.js)的超集(后缀.ts)包含并扩展了 JavaScript 的语法,需要被编译输出为 JavaScri...
vue-cli项目如何用babel将es6转码为es5?vue项目用的es6语法,如何用babel-cli将es6转码为es5?求大神...
vue cli3 ios12报错不支持es6,那么改怎么转成es5呢? SmallForest 2391413 发布于 2019-12-30 项目使用的是vue-cli3生成出来的。打包出来的项目在iPhone6s,ios13运行时可以的,IOS12运行就报错。提示不支持es6的语法。网上看了很多教程仍然无法解决。vue-cli手册提到了浏览器兼容性。也尝试修改了,应该是我水平不...
webpack es6转es5原理_webpack和vue cli区别 大家好,又见面了,我是你们的朋友全栈君。 首先下载babel-loader npm install –save-dev babel-loader@7 babel-core babel-preset-es2015 要在最外部输入指令不然会报错然后在webpack.config.js中写相关代码...
Babel 解释器的配置文件,存放在根目录下。Babel 是一个转码器,项目里需要用它将ES6代码转为ES5代码。如果你想了解更多,可以查看 babel 的知识。{//设定转码规则"presets": [ ["env", { "modules": false }], "stage-2"],//转码用的插件"plugins": ["transform-runtime"],"comments": false,//...
Babel解释器的配置文件,存放在根目录下。Babel是一个转码器,项目里需要用它将ES6代码转为ES5代码。如果你想了解更多,可以查看babel的知识。 1234567891011121314151617 { //设定转码规则 "presets": [ ["env", { "modules": false }], "stage-2" ], //转码用的插件 "plugins": ["transform-runtime"], "...